compare the sensory system and nervous system

Respuesta :

sukanyasingha0413 sukanyasingha0413
  • 13-05-2022

Answer:

The sensory system is the portion of the nervous system responsible for processing input from the environment. Beginning with detection through the transfer of stimuli to the central nervous system, the peripheral nerves and their associated receptors rapidly relay information.
